Dan Magenheimer wrote:
Before we close down this thread, I have a concern:

According to Mukesh, the fix to this bug is dependent
on the pv drivers tracking tot_pages for a domain
and ballooning to ensure tot_pages+3 does not exceed
max_pages for the domain.

Well, tmem can affect tot_pages for a domain inside
the hypervisor without any notification to pv drivers
or the balloon driver.  And I'd imagine that PoD and
future memory optimization mechanisms such as
swapping and page-sharing may do the same.

So this solution seems very fragile.
